The Covid-19 pandemic is increasingly seen as a watershed moment in business — beyond its obvious human cost, shocked supply chains around the world are scrambling to cope with the impact of lost production capacity. As factories struggle to keep up with the demand there are real fears that some industries could be crippled by the economic fallout. In this programme, we look at the companies adapting their manufacturing processes to deal with the crisis and examine what it means for hi-tech manufacturing when it comes to embracing new technologies and meeting sustainability goals.

SMAC Moving Coil Actuators is a leading manufacturer of precision programmable electric actuators based on moving coil technology. Their actuators are unique in that force, position, and speed are totally programmable. The company takes pride in the quality, speed and reliability of its products.
